Understanding Groves Title Loan Agreements

Groves Title Loans agreements are designed to be legally binding contracts between the lender and the borrower. These agreements outline the terms and conditions of the loan, including interest rates, repayment schedules, and collateral requirements. Understanding every clause is crucial for borrowers, as it ensures they know their financial obligations and rights.
When taking out a Groves Title Loan, a credit check is typically conducted to assess the borrower’s creditworthiness. This process helps lenders determine eligibility and sets the foundation for a potential loan payoff. As these loans often serve as a financial solution for individuals with limited access to traditional banking services, borrowers should carefully review the agreement to avoid any unexpected fees or terms that could impact their overall financial health.
Disclosing and Verifying Borrower Information

When applying for Groves title loans, lenders must ensure they collect and verify accurate borrower information. This includes verifying the applicant’s identity, income, and employment status to assess loan eligibility. Lenders often request documents like driver’s licenses, pay stubs, or tax returns to confirm these details.
Disclosing this information upfront is crucial for a seamless lending process. Borrowers should provide honest and complete data to ensure quick approval and same-day funding. Lenders use this information to determine the borrower’s financial health and their ability to repay the loan, which is essential in managing risk and providing responsible credit access.
Repayment Obligations and Consequences of Default

When taking out a Groves title loan, borrowers must be fully aware of their repayment obligations. These loans are secured by the borrower’s vehicle ownership, which means failure to repay can result in severe consequences. In the event of default, lenders have the right to repossess the collateral, typically the vehicle associated with the title. This process is a legal right and a common practice for Fort Worth loans and motorcycle title loans, ensuring lenders are protected financially.
Repossession is not the only outcome; borrowers may also face additional fees and penalties. These can include repossession costs, late payment charges, and even legal expenses if the matter goes to court. It’s crucial for borrowers to understand that neglecting repayment could impact their vehicle ownership rights and lead to significant financial losses. Therefore, clear communication about repayment terms and timely action in case of default are essential practices for both parties involved in such transactions.
